The energy at Joy Ghana Fest 2026 is palpable as thousands of patrons throng the Achimota Retail Center to shop, explore, and enjoy a weekend of fun-filled experiences.
The three-day event has quickly become a hotspot for locals eager to discover the best of Ghanaian brands while enjoying interactive activities and entertainment.

Since the gates opened, shoppers have been browsing stalls offering fashion, food, crafts, and other locally made products, all under the Ghana Month theme of “Buy Ghana, Wear Ghana, Eat Ghana.”
Beyond shopping, patrons have been entertained with a variety of fun activities. Choreographed dance performances on the main stage have kept the energy high, while karaoke sessions are expected to follow soon to allow attendees to sing along to favorite Ghanaian hits.

Organisers say the event is designed to be more than just a marketplace; it is a celebration of local businesses, innovation, and community engagement.


With the event running through Sunday, March 22, patrons can look forward to more shopping opportunities, live entertainment, interactive competitions, and moments of fun designed to showcase the best of Ghanaian products and experiences.
